About The Position

We are seeking a dedicated and skilled Medical Laboratory Technologist/Technician to join our team at the White Earth Service Unit. The MT/MLT will provide emergency and routine laboratory services to eligible patients of all ages, including children, adults, and the elderly. The ideal candidate will perform specimen collection, processing, testing, and reporting with a high degree of accuracy and professionalism.

Requirements

  • Valid ASCP certification as a Medical Technologist (MT) or Medical Laboratory Technician (MLT).
  • State licensure, if required.
  • Current Basic Life Support (BLS) certification.
  • Minimum of one (1) year of specialized experience in Phlebotomy and specimen collection procedures.
  • Minimum of one (1) year of specialized experience in Accessioning and specimen preparation.
  • Minimum of one (1) year of specialized experience in Specimen analysis and reporting within a clinical laboratory or medical center setting.
  • Proficient in calibrating and operating analytical instruments.
  • Skilled in interpreting and evaluating laboratory test results.
  • Fluent in speaking, understanding, reading, and writing English.
  • Strong understanding of medical terminology and laboratory practices.
  • Knowledge of microbiology, chemistry, physiology, and anatomy.
  • Familiarity with quality control, proficiency testing, and quality assurance procedures.
  • Ability to address age-specific needs of pediatric, adolescent, adult, and geriatric patients.

Responsibilities

  • Collect specimens from patients across all age groups.
  • Prepare and process specimens for routine testing or package them for referral to external laboratories.
  • Perform and monitor routine and specialized tests in areas such as microbiology, hematology, chemistry, urinalysis, and serology.
  • Calibrate and operate analytical instruments independently.
  • Interpret and evaluate test results, recognizing deviations from normal values.
  • Repeat tests when results are inconsistent and report abnormalities to the supervisor.
  • Conduct quality control procedures on equipment, reagents, and products.
  • Troubleshoot and resolve quality control issues as needed.
  • Participate in laboratory proficiency testing and quality assurance programs.
  • Perform preventive maintenance on all instruments and identify the need for external service when necessary.
  • Adhere to all laboratory procedures and safety protocols, including infection control practices.
  • Use personal protective equipment to protect against exposure to infectious diseases.
  • Follow accreditation standards, IHS policies, and applicable laws and regulations.
  • Complete and file laboratory reports accurately and in a timely manner.
  • Maintain accurate records of all tests performed and results obtained.
  • Order and maintain laboratory supplies.
  • Keep the laboratory area clean, organized, and safe.
  • Assist in the continuous quality improvement programs of the clinic.
  • Provide services in a professional and respectful manner to patients and colleagues.
  • Stay current with developments in medical terminology, laboratory practices, and related disciplines.
